标签: sparse-matrix blas intel-mkl
英特尔MKL中有BLAS的稀疏版本,例如做矩阵和向量的乘法,我们可以使用
mkl_?coogemv
计算存储在其中的稀疏通用矩阵的矩阵向量积 带有基于索引的坐标格式
但我听说乘法在CSR存储中更有效率。
然而,生成CSR存储稀疏矩阵是一个令人头疼的问题,生成COO存储稀疏矩阵非常容易理解。
我想知道的是:使用coogemv时,MKL会在内部将COO存储空间更改为CSR存储吗?文档没有说明。
coogemv